Output 90834186051abe81a047fadacde7aa7db435e2b30cd3d1619d54ed5ee83035e6:0

value
700817955
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11c11c839e2029c3d7bb7766d011b1695f5b3ac3 OP_EQUALVERIFY OP_CHECKSIG
address
12cspsmNBvYNwQ9S2VD7oWThSq6BgVUKMg
transaction
90834186051abe81a047fadacde7aa7db435e2b30cd3d1619d54ed5ee83035e6
spent
true